New Delhi, March 30 -- The spirit of Eid-ul-Fitr has officially arrived in Pakistan, as the Shawwal 1446 crescent moon was sighted in various cities, including Lahore, Islamabad and Faisalabad. The joyous festival will be celebrated across the country on Monday, March 31, 2025.
The eagerly awaited announcement was made by Maulana Abdul Khabir Azad, Chairman of the Central Ruet-e-Hilal Committee, during a press conference in Islamabad on Sunday evening. Addressing the media, Maulana Azad confirmed that credible moon sighting testimonies were received from multiple locations nationwide.
